Containerized energy storage systems are engineered to operate under extreme environmental conditions. With corrosion-resistant shells, IP54+ protection levels, and advanced thermal management (air- or liquid-cooling), they thrive in deserts, coastal zones, and mountainous terrains. What is a solar container build?

It's a modified shipping container built to house solar panels, batteries, inverters, and other off-grid power systems. These units are ideal for powering remote sites, construction camps, emergency setups, or as a portable backup energy system. What's included in a solar container build?
